Form 4: SunOpta Inc. Executive Justin Kobler Reports Stock Option and Restricted Stock Unit Acquisition

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Justin Kobler, SVP of Supply Chain at SunOpta Inc., reports the acquisition of stock options and restricted stock units.

Summary

  • On April 11, 2025, Justin Kobler, SVP of Supply Chain at SunOpta Inc., acquired 41,494 stock options with an exercise price of $3.92.
  • These options vest in three equal annual installments starting April 11, 2026, contingent upon continued employment, and expire 10 years from the award date.
  • Kobler also acquired 19,594 restricted stock units (RSUs), each representing a contingent right to receive one share of STKL common stock.
  • These RSUs vest in three equal annual installments beginning April 11, 2026, also subject to continued employment, and do not have an expiration date.
  • The reported transactions were filed under Section 16(a)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934.
